The Installation Process

The installation of a back entrance involves several steps, which can differ depending on the intricacy of the job and the type of door being set up. Below is a basic outline of a common installation process:

  1. Consultation: The installer examines the area where the door will be put and goes over design choices with the house owner.
  2. Elimination of the Old Door: The old door and its frame are thoroughly removed, making sure that no damage is done to surrounding areas.
  3. Preparation: The opening for the new door is prepared. This might include changes to the framing to ensure a proper fit.
  4. Installation of the New Door: The brand-new door is installed according to the producer's instructions and structure codes. This includes securing it to the frame and ensuring it runs correctly.
  5. Weatherproofing: Proper sealing and weatherstripping are applied to reduce drafts and prevent water seepage.
  6. Finishing Touches: The installer will make final changes, set up hardware, and guarantee everything is operating properly. A clean-up of the workspace is also carried out.

FAQs About Back Door Installation

Q1: How much does it cost to install a back door?A1: The cost can differ commonly based upon the type of door, materials, and labor. Typically, installation costs can range from ₤ 500 to ₤ 1,500.

Q2: How long does it take to set up a back door?A2: Most setups can be finished within a few hours, but more complicated tasks may take a complete day.

Q3: What type of back entrance is best for energy effectiveness?A3: Doors made from fiberglass or steel typically supply better insulation and energy effectiveness than wood options.

Q4: Can I set up a back entrance myself?A4: While DIY installation is possible, it's advised to hire a qualified installer to make sure security and compliance with local codes.

Q5: What should I do if my back door is not closing correctly?A5: If a door is not closing properly, it could be due to incorrect installation or issues with the door frame. Consult a professional for an extensive evaluation.
